My methodology is based on following the method that best suits the student. If the student is interested, for example, in getting started with classical music, we would work on technique exercises, as well as studies or pieces designed for this purpose. There would also be a classical repertoire component, while at the same time giving the student the option to work on any type of music they wish. These classes would also include basic music theory to begin familiarizing themselves with reading sheet music. If the student wishes to learn a specific type of music other than classical, such as jazz, blues, or pop, the same methods would be applied, but adapted to these different musical genres. Even so, I am flexible in dividing the class as the student wishes, focusing solely on learning to play, or covering more ground by delving into the theory and practices that lie beyond mere practice. In my piano teaching method, I would combine the classical training I've received and found relevant with modern musical methods such as improvisation and ear training. My lessons would be structured, for example, as follows: - We would begin with an articulation warm-up, followed by some technical exercises to familiarize the hand. Articulation exercises played together with the teacher would also be included. - Afterwards, we would play a technical piece, such as an étude, prelude, invention... Alternatively, we could dedicate part of the lesson to working on a musical aspect, such as scales, chords, and scale degrees. - And we would conclude by playing a piece/song requested by the student. Finally, I would like to clarify that I am open to make an agreement with the student on the theoretical, practical, and thematic structure of the lessons.

Do you have trouble reading music? Do you love listening to music, but don't understand time signatures, keys or chords? Music theory often sounds abstract, but with the right explanation and concrete examples it suddenly becomes a lot more logical, and even fun :) For whom? - Beginner or advanced musicians who want to better understand what they are doing. - Students preparing for music theory exams (e.g. music school, entrance exams). - Independent artists/producers who want to deepen their musical knowledge. - Anyone who is curious about the language behind music. What can you expect? - Clear explanation, at your own pace. - Theory made immediately applicable with examples on the piano. - Extra attention to insight instead of learning dry rules by heart. - Tutoring fully tailored to your level and goal (classical, pop, songwriting, production, ...). About me I obtained a Grade 8 diploma in Music Theory and also a Grade 8 Piano from the Royal Schools of Music. In addition, I hold a diploma in Audio Engineering from Hofa College. I am active as a music artist and producer myself. Thanks to this combination of classical training and practical experience, I know how important it is to make theory understandable, concrete, and musical. I use my own piano during lessons to clarify everything visually and audibly. Possible topics: - Learn to read music. - Scales, chords & harmony. - Form and analysis (classical, jazz or pop). - Rhythm, time signatures & tempo. - Music theory for producers/songwriters. - Songwriting. - Preparation for exams or entrance tests.
